If straight-line speed is your priority, the GSX-R1000R takes the lead. With 80 HP more than the R9, it offers a more spirited ride that will be noticeable on highway overtakes or track days. When it comes to agility, the R9 has a clear advantage. Weighing in 8kg less than the GSX-R1000R, it will feel significantly easier to handle in low-speed traffic, parking maneuvers, and twisty corners. Bottom Line: While both are capable, the gsxr1000 offers a superior power-to-weight ratio, making it the more exciting machine for experienced riders.
| Spec | GSX-R1000R | R9 |
|---|---|---|
| Displacement | 1000 | 890 |
| Power | 199 | 119 |
| Cylinders | 4 | 3 |
| Weight | 203 | 195 |
| Seat height | 825 | 830 |
